Pricing and Property Types: What Can You Afford?

Let’s talk numbers. Real estate prices in Toscana can vary significantly depending on the size of the lot, the house design, and its location within the subdivision. As of today, you can expect to find vacant lots starting at around PHP 8,000,000 for a 200 square meter lot, while houses can range from PHP 15,000,000 to upwards of PHP 30,000,000 or more for larger, more luxurious homes. Remember, these are just estimates, and prices fluctuate depending on the market. You can often find updated listings on property websites, such as Lamudi Philippines, for a better idea of current prices.

As for property types, you’ll find a mix of single-family homes, some townhouses, and even vacant lots for those who want to build their dream house from scratch. Many houses feature modern designs, with open floor plans and spacious gardens. The size of the house typically range from 150 square meters to well over 300 square meters. The houses often have multiple bedrooms, bathrooms, and car garages.

Average Lot/House Prices: A Closer Look at the Numbers

As mentioned earlier, average prices can vary quite a bit, but let’s break it down further. For a standard 200 square meter lot in a good location within Toscana, you can expect to pay around PHP 40,000 per square meter, putting the total price at PHP 8,000,000. Houses typically start at around PHP 15,000,000 for a 3-bedroom, 2-bathroom home with a floor area of around 150 square meters. Larger houses with more bedrooms, bathrooms, and amenities can easily fetch prices upwards of PHP 30,000,000. Keep in mind that these are just averages, and prices can vary depending on the specific property and the current market conditions.

Rental Income Potential: Can You Rent Out Your Property?

If you’re considering buying a property in Toscana as an investment, you might be wondering about the rental income potential. There is definitely a demand for rental properties in the area, particularly from expats, professionals, and families who are relocating to Davao City. You can expect to earn a decent rental income from your property, especially if it’s well-maintained and located in a desirable part of the subdivision. Monthly rental rates for houses in Toscana typically range from PHP 50,000 to PHP 100,000 or more, depending on the size and amenities of the property.

Airbnb Feasibility: A Short-Term Rental Option?

While long-term rentals are common, Airbnb feasibility in Toscana is something to carefully consider. Subdivisions often have restrictions on short-term rentals to maintain the peace and privacy of residents. Check the homeowner’s association (HOA) rules and regulations regarding Airbnb before considering this option. Even if it’s allowed, competition from other Airbnb properties in the area might affect your occupancy rates and rental income. Long-term rentals might be a safer and more stable option in this case.

Schools and Education: Learning Opportunities for Your Children

For families with children, access to good schools is a top priority. Toscana is located near several reputable schools, both private and public. These schools offer a range of educational programs, from pre-school to high school. Some of the popular schools in the area include Ateneo de Davao University, Davao Christian High School, and Precious International School of Davao. Consider the location of these schools relative to your property and the school’s curriculum and tuition fees when making your decision.
